Chuan Guo is a research scientist specializing in 3D human motion modeling with seven years of experience spanning industry and academia, currently building motion systems for VR at Meta Reality Labs. He holds a PhD in Computer Engineering from the University of Alberta and has driven high-impact projects at Snap, Huawei Noah’s Ark Lab, and CAS, including large-scale motion-language datasets and publications at ECCV and CVPR. His work blends generative models (temporal VAEs and transformer-based VAEs) with production engineering—shipping automated 3D animation pipelines and data collection frameworks that powered novel motion and interaction features. Comfortable moving between research and product, he has a proven track record of turning motion-language research into scalable datasets and tools used in commercial AR/VR experiences. An early focus on real-time systems and fake-news detection also underscores his aptitude for building distributed data platforms and pragmatic ML deployments.
